Website TMĐT trang sản phẩm tự động sinh ra URL lỗi

Huỳnh Đức

Moderator
Xin chào ae SEO trong cộng đồng! Website bán hàng của em đang gặp một lỗi kỹ thuật như này.

Website tự động sinh ra hàng loạt URL trùng lặp kèm theo một dãy số ngẫu nhiên phía sau các đường link sản phẩm, ví dụ: domain/sanpham/sanpham-1/4847848973474
domain/sanpham/sanpham2/5749337874836
...
Mọi người đã có ai gặp lỗi này chưa. Lỗi này thường do đâu? (Do Plugin, do Cấu hình CMS,...?)
Giờ có quá nhiều URL trùng lặp này có gây ra hậu quả gì cho SEO ko? và em cũng đang chạy Facebook Ads thì có bị ảnh hưởng gì ko?

Giờ em cần Canonical, Redirect 301, hay chặn Robots luôn? AE nào có giải pháp giúp em!
 
lỗi này chắc do cấu hình sai của CMS hoặc do thanh số tracking/filter bị lưu lại. có thể do sessionID hoặc id tracking của plugin nào đấy, bạn vào các plugin đã install xem lại thử
 
mấy web bán hàng thường hay dính lỗi này. Này bạn xem fix liền vì nhiều trang mà giống nhau bị xem là duplicate Content và bị Google tụt hạng mấy trang chính bây giờ
 
trước tiên bạn cứ canonical về URL gốc trước tiên. Nếu website bạn là wordpress thì yoast seo hay rank math có đó
 
bạn dùng screaming frog để quét hết toàn bộ url trên website đi, xem toàn quy mô web bị ảnh hưởng nặng ko. Sợ phải sửa thủ công khá mệt
 
Nếu các tham số phía sau dãy số là cố định (ví dụ: ?session=), bạn có thể dùng lệnh Disallow trong robots.txt để chặn Googlebot thu thập các URL chứa tham số đó, không là ảnh hưởng SEO nặng nha
 
bạn rà soát lại tất cả các Plugin/Theme mới cài đặt gần đây thử coi, đặc biệt là các plugin về Filter Sản phẩm (Lọc theo màu, size,...) hoặc tối ưu Cache/tốc độ. Rất nhiều lỗi URL được sinh ra từ các plugin này dễ xung đột nhau lắm.
 
bạn rà soát lại tất cả các Plugin/Theme mới cài đặt gần đây thử coi, đặc biệt là các plugin về Filter Sản phẩm (Lọc theo màu, size,...) hoặc tối ưu Cache/tốc độ. Rất nhiều lỗi URL được sinh ra từ các plugin này dễ xung đột nhau lắm.
Cảm ơn các bác! Em nghĩ chắc đúng là do plugin lọc sản phẩm rồi. chắc phải thêm Canonical Tag. Sau khi Canonical thì em có cần 301 các URL lỗi đó không ạ, hay chỉ Canonical là đủ?
 
Cảm ơn các bác! Em nghĩ chắc đúng là do plugin lọc sản phẩm rồi. chắc phải thêm Canonical Tag. Sau khi Canonical thì em có cần 301 các URL lỗi đó không ạ, hay chỉ Canonical là đủ?
Canonical là đủ rồi bác. Ko cần dùng 301 vì nó sẽ chuyển hướng vĩnh viễn và có thể gây lỗi vòng lặp nếu lỗi sinh URL không được sửa triệt để đấy.
 
Mình từng bị y hệt trên WordPress do cái Plugin Jetpack hoặc WP Rocket cấu hình sai phần Mobile Version. Bạn thử kiểm tra lại các plugin liên quan đến tối ưu hóa hoặc lưu bộ nhớ đệm xem.
 
Cảm ơn các bác! Em nghĩ chắc đúng là do plugin lọc sản phẩm rồi. chắc phải thêm Canonical Tag. Sau khi Canonical thì em có cần 301 các URL lỗi đó không ạ, hay chỉ Canonical là đủ?
Bạn vào mục Trang (Pages) xem có bị cảnh báo "Duplicate without user-selected canonical" không. Nếu có hàng nghìn link như vậy, thif dùng công cụ URL Parameters trong GSC để báo với Google bỏ qua dãy số đó.
 
Back
Bên trên